The migration of Brindlewick's build to the hermetic Ovenlock system is about halfway done. All Go and Rust targets now build hermetically; the legacy asset pipeline does not, and you'll see nondeterministic outputs there until Q3. As a new contractor, you mostly need to know which targets are migrated and how to declare dependencies explicitly — undeclared inputs fail the sandbox, which is the most common stumbling block. The migration tracker, target status table, and sandbox troubleshooting guide are all kept on the internal page here.

operations page: https://jenkins.zemvarcloud.local/job/merge_requests/repo/build/73930b4b30f0a8ed

Subject: On-call heads-up — Orchardly catalog cache. Welcome aboard. The main gotcha: catalog price updates invalidate by SKU, but bundle pages cache composite keys, so a stale bundle can outlive its parts. If support reports wrong bundle prices, purge the composite namespace first. We'll cover this at the weekly sync; the invalidation playbook is on this internal page.

wiki page, yagef-tawif: https://sentry.lumicdata.local/view/merge_requests/pipeline/merge_requests/e08f7f35c80b5755

Hey — handing off Cratewise, the pick-list optimizer, before my rotation ends. Security notes: route scoring runs in the Pellford enclave, configs are signed, and nothing leaves the warehouse LAN. One thing for your review: the sealed config bundle needs the team recovery credential to open. For your audit, the passphrase is printed directly below this line.

unlock words, hafop-tahog: drumir-druiel-kasox-wenax-tamys-frair

## Striderchip Reader — Limits & Quotas

The Striderchip mat readers throttle tag reads per antenna to avoid RF collisions at dense start corrals. Exceeding the burst cap drops duplicate pings, not first reads. Raising limits requires sign-off from the Kettleford timing team. Current values are below.

limits module of tafop-hahop:
WEIGHTS = {
    "julmir": 223,
    "belox": 987,
    "lamion": 470,
    "pelath": 609,
    "fraok": 1010,
    "eliion": 343,
    "drudor": 342,
}